Viewed directly from above against a pristine white surface, this densely packed autumn bouquet reads like a small harvest composed in colour and texture. The central focus is a generous cluster of large roses, each blossom showing a nuanced bicolour: warm peach and soft orange at the heart melting outward into coral and then russet-tinted outer petals, the edges slightly darker as if kissed by the first cool evenings of fall. Intermingled with the roses are clusters of Hypericum berries, some pulsing a bright lime-green, others a gentle creamy yellow, their smooth, bead-like forms creating tiny highlights across the arrangement. Sprays of green trick dianthus provide surprising, velvety, moss-like texture, sitting low and thick against the blooms and offering visual contrast that feels organic and tactile. Prominent, lobed leaves in deep burgundy and reddish brown are distributed throughout, reminiscent of fallen oak or maple leaves you might find underfoot near Kilburn High Road or the quieter lanes toward Maida Vale - they deepen the composition and reinforce the seasonal story. Glossy green foliage with broader leaves fills the framework, lending fullness and a fresh, leafy backdrop that supports the roses and berries. Light is soft and even, casting mild shadows that sculpt the bouquet's round form and highlight the interplay between smooth petals, bead-like berries and the dense dianthus. The arrangement carries a gentle, earthy aroma - rose sweetness shaded with green, mossy notes - and is composed to serve as an elegant Thanksgiving or harvest table centrepiece, a warming gift for someone in Kilburn, or a sophisticated seasonal addition to home decor.

Capture the cosy glow of autumn with our Pumpkin Pie bouquet from Kilburn Florist. This warm, seasonal flower arrangement blends rich orange roses, fresh freesia and glossy hypericum berries, finished with oak leaves and lush greenery for a beautifully textured, harvest-inspired look. Designed to bring the colours of fall indoors, it's a thoughtful choice for birthdays, thank-you gifts, dinner parties or simply brightening your home.

Each Pumpkin Pie bouquet is handcrafted by our expert Kilburn florists using premium, long-lasting stems. Flowers are delivered in bud to maximise vase life, so you can enjoy the full journey as they unfurl and bloom over several days. We guarantee 5 days of freshness, giving you confidence in the quality of your flowers.

Available for next day flower delivery in Kilburn and surrounding areas when you order before 4pm, this autumn bouquet is perfect for last-minute surprises. Due to seasonal availability, some stems may be substituted with flowers of a similar colour, style and value, ensuring your arrangement always looks full, fresh and beautifully balanced.
